I'm beginning to work on invite faucets: inviters create links to share that give invitees sats when they sign up.
@abetusk and @gmd suggested this. I suspect my design converges on what most people would expect, but want to see if there's any variance.
I'll be modeling it roughly after telegram's invite model. Inviters can create links with:
  1. amount of sats to award invitee
  2. invitee limit
At any point, the inviter can revoke the link or create others. Invites will also have stats like number of people who have joined and amount of sats awarded through the link.
